Mexico probing possible U.S. violation in drug lord capture: "Someone lied"
Mexico's government is scrutinizing if the U.S. breached its sovereignty during the 2024 capture of notorious drug lord Ismael "El Mayo" Zambada, suggesting someone might have misled them.
